2SD1302R Overview

Small Signal Bipolar Transistor, 0.5A I(C), 20V V(BR)CEO, 1-Element, NPN, Silicon, TO-92, ROHS COMPLIANT, TO-92-B1, 3 PIN

2SD1302R Parametric

Parameter NameAttribute value
Is it Rohs certified?conform to
Parts packaging codeTO-92
package instructionCYLINDRICAL, O-PBCY-T3
Contacts3
Reach Compliance Codeunknow
ECCN codeEAR99
Maximum collector current (IC)0.5 A
Collector-emitter maximum voltage20 V
ConfigurationSINGLE
Minimum DC current gain (hFE)200
JEDEC-95 codeTO-92
JESD-30 codeO-PBCY-T3
Number of components1
Number of terminals3
Maximum operating temperature150 °C
Package body materialPLASTIC/EPOXY
Package shapeROUND
Package formCYLINDRICAL
Peak Reflow Temperature (Celsius)NOT SPECIFIED
Polarity/channel typeNPN
Maximum power dissipation(Abs)0.6 W
Certification statusNot Qualified
surface mountNO
Terminal formTHROUGH-HOLE
Terminal locationBOTTOM
Maximum time at peak reflow temperatureNOT SPECIFIED
transistor applicationsSWITCHING
Transistor component materialsSILICON
Nominal transition frequency (fT)200 MHz
Base Number Matches1
